Yanga striker Kennedy Musonda is likely to join Al Ittihad, a club that plays in the Libyan Premier League, it has been learned
A source close to the striker has indicated that Musonda has already reached a personal agreement with Al Ittihad and is waiting for the end of his contract with Yanga to join the Libyan giants
Musonda's contract expires at the end of the season and so far there have been no talks over a new contract
Musonda has served Yanga for two and a half seasons since he joined the national champions from Zambia's Power Dynamos
Recurrent injuries this season have kept him out of the game while strikers Clement Mzize and Prince Dube seem to be doing better than him
Musonda was part of the squad that won the Muungano Zanzibar title last week, however he played only one match in the quarter-finals against KVZ, which he failed to complete 90 minutes after injury
